"Students are allocated a house and invited to join clubs and societies spanning everything from chess to technology, sculpting, and debate," says a member of the pastoral team. "It's about creating a sense of belonging - even in a digital space."And yes, they meet in real life, too, typically at festivals or competitions. Are online schools accredited? In 2023, the UK government launched the Online Education Accreditation Scheme (OEAS) to ensure consistent standards across virtual schools.

SCROLLING estate agent websites at 2am, my heart pounding, I wonder how I got to this place. As a divorced mum of three, who had always worked hard to put a roof over our heads, I had no idea where my family would be living in the coming weeks. Despite reliably paying the rent on our four-bedroom property in Leatherhead, Surrey, for the past two years, I was still served with a “no fault” Section 21 eviction notice just before Christmas.

Jump directly to the contentSoapsRealityDramaFilmLove IslandThe 1990s legend took a dig at the ITV presenter with his rantMR Motivator has blasted ITV — saying he could do a better job than presenters such as Family Fortunes’ Gino D’Acampo. The Lycra-clad fitness favourite, real name Derrick Evans, feels snubbed by the broadcaster with whom he found fame in the 1990s. The 72-year-old said: “I have earned the position where I should have my own show.

Carol Vorderman, the well-known TV star and former presenter of Countdown, has recently spoken out about the pervasive problematic culture in the television industry. . In the wake of the recent allegations against Gregg Wallace, she suggested that these issues are merely the tip of the iceberg in an industry rife with long-standing issues. . Vorderman, at 63 years of age, stated unequivocally: "It's about keeping people down, particularly women. And it's not just Gregg Wallace.
